    STL export refers to the process of converting 3D models into the STL (Stereolithography) file format, which is widely used in 3D printing and computer-aided design (CAD). This format allows for the representation of the surface geometry of a three-dimensional object. In SketchUp, a popular modeling software, users can easily export their designs as STL files, facilitating the transition from digital models to physical objects. This is crucial for professionals in various fields, including architecture and engineering. The ability to export in STL format enhances productivity and efficiency.

    Moreover, STL files are essential for 3D printing, as they provide the necessary data for printers to create accurate representations of the original model. He can visualize the final product before it is physically created. This capability is particularly valuable in prototyping and product development. By utilizing STL export, users can ensure that their designs are not only visually appealing but also functional. It is a game-changer in the design process.

    In SketchUp, the export process is straightforward, allowing users to select specific settings that can impact the quality of tje final output. He should pay attention to factors such as resolution and detail level. These settings can significantly influence the fidelity of the printed model. A higher declaration often results in a more detailed print. However, it may also lead to larger file sizes , which can complicate the printing process. Balancing quality and file size is essential for optimal results.

    Understanding SketchUp Export Settings

    Overview of Export Options

    When exporting models from SketchUp, users encounter various options that can significantly affect the final output. Understanding these export settings is crucial for achieving the desired results. He should be aware of the different file formats available, including STL, OBJ, and DWG. Each format serves specific purposes and has unique characteristics. For example, STL is commonly used for 3D printing, while OBJ is suitable for rendering and animation.

    The following table summarizes key export formats and their applications:

    Format Application Key Features STL 3D Printing Simple geometry representation OBJ Rendering and Animation Supports textures and colors DWG CAD Software Widely used in engineering

    He can choose the format that best fits his project needs. Additionally, users can adjust settings such as resolution and scale during the export process. Higher resolution settings yield more detailed models, which is essential for intricate designs. However, this may also increase file size, complicating the printing process. He must equipoise detail with practicality.

    Another important aspect is the selection of export options related to geometry. Users can choose to export only selected entities or the entire model. This flexibility allows for more efficient workflows, especially when dealing with large projects. He should consider which parts of the model are necessary for the final output. It can save time and resources.

    Testing and Validating Your STL Files

    Using Software to Check STL Integrity

    Using software to check STL integrity is a crucial step in ensuring that 3D models are ready for printing. This process involves validating the geometry of the STL files to identify any errors that could lead to printing failures. He should utilize specialized software tools designed for this purpose. These tools can detect issues such as non-manifold edges, holes, and overlapping faces. Identifying these problems early can save time and resources.

    Common software options for checking STL integrity include MeshLab, Netfabb, and Simplify3D. Each of these programs offers unique features that facilitate the analysis of STL files. For instance, MeshLab provides a comprehensive suite of tools for repairing and optimizing mesh structures. He can use these features to enhance the quality of his models. It is a valuable resource for professionals.

    Additionally, users should perform a visual inspection of the STL file within the software. This step allows for a quick assessment of the model’s overall appearance and structure. He should look for any obvious defects that may not be detected by automated tools. A thorough review can prevent potential issues during the printing process. It is an essential practice for quality assurance.

    Furthermore, validating STL files against specific printing requirements is important. He should ensure that the model adheres to the specifications of the 3D printer being used. This includes checking dimensions, scaling, and material compatibility. By aligning the model with these parameters, he can enhance the likelihood of a successful print. This attention to detail is critical in professional applications.

    In summary, utilizing software to check STL integrity is a fundamental practice for ensuring high-quality 3D prints. He can achieve better results by validating and optimizing his models before printing. This proactive approach can lead to improved efficiency and reduced costs in the long run.

    Importance of SNMP in Network Management

    SNMP, or Simple Network Management Protocol, plays a critical role in network management by enabling the monitoring and control of network devices. This protocol facilitates communication between network devices and management systems, allowing for efficient data collection and analysis. Effective monitoring is essential for maintaining network health. It helps prevent potential issues before they escalate.

    One of the key advantages of SNMP is its ability to provide real-time insights into network performance. By gathering data on device status, traffic patterns, and error rates, network administrators can make informed decisions. Informed decisions lead to better outcomes. This proactive approach minimizes downtime and enhances overall productivity.

    Moreover, SNMP supports a wide range of devices, from routers and switches to servers and printers. This versatility makes it an invaluable tool for diverse network environments. A diverse network requires adaptable solutions. SNMP meets this need effectively.

    Additionally, SNMP allows for automated alerts and notifications, which are crucial for timely responses to network issues. By setting thresholds for various parameters, administrators can receive alerts when performance deviates from the norm. Timely alerts can save resources. They enable quick action to mitigate problems.

    Security Considerations

    When utilizing SnmpTrapGen, it is crucial to adhere to best practices to ensure the security of your network and data. First, always use strong, unique passwords for SNMP community strings. Weak passwords can lead to unauthorized access. Additionally, consider implementing access control lists (ACLs) to restrict which devices can send or receive SNMP traps. This minimizes the risk of interception. Security is paramount.

    Furthermore, ensure that SNMPv3 is used whenever possible, as it provides enhanced security features such as authentication and encryption. This version significantly reduces the risk of data breaches. Encryption is essential. Regularly update your SNMP software to patch vulnerabilities. Outdated software can be an easy target for attackers. Stay updated.

    Monitoring SNMP traffic is also advisable. By analyzing logs, you can detect unusual patterns that may indicate a security threat. Awareness is key. Implementing network segmentation can further protect sensitive data by isolating critical systems from less secure areas. This adds an duplicate layer of security. Always be vigilant.

    Lastly, educate your team about the importance of SNMP security . Regular training can help prevent human errors that lead to security breaches. Knowledge is power. By following these best practices, you can significantly enhance the security of your SNMP implementations. Secure your network today.
